What is summer staff?
​Each summer Camp Assurance hires approximately 24 young people to fulfill various ministry roles. We hire 8 counselors who should have at least one year of college training. The remaining positions are for operational staff, who must be at least 16 years old by June 1st. These positions include working in the kitchen, snack shop, craft shop, coffee shop, maintenance, hospitality, as well as certified lifeguards, nurse, and program staff.
Under 16 years old 
Check out our T.I.M.E. Program
Summer staff work and pray hard daily to provide a Christ-centered camp experience for the children. The fruits of their labors are children getting saved, growing spiritually, and being challenged to serve God with their own lives.

Your mission includes spending two months of your summer to serve campers of all ages. We ask godly young people, like you, to show Christ to each child through their words and life. Camp Assurance is a missions organization and another challenge will be raising your support to work this summer as a camp staff member. 
Picture
As a missionary enterprise, Camp Assurance asks summer missionaries to raise their own financial support. The camp also encourages camp supporters to give to the SAFE Fund. (Staff Assistance For Education) This money is divided among the summer missionaries to help them pay for college expenses.
Summer Staff Positions
Counselors (8 positions)
  • ​4 Guys; 4 Girls - responsible for cabin of 6-10 campers each week
Common Grounds Supervisor/Barista (1 position)
  • Oversees the operation of the coffee shop including beverage preparation, transactions, & cleaning 
Snack Shop Supervisor (1 position)
  • ​Oversees stocking of products and selling of store goods
​Craft Shop Supervisor (1 position)
  • ​Oversees craft projects and selling of store goods
Lifeguards (2 positions)
  • ​1 Guy; 1 Girl - provide safety instruction for campers during pool time & activities
​ Kitchen Assistants (5 positions)
  • ​Assist the cook with meal prep, dishes, cleaning, and dining hall setup
Nurse/First-Aid personnel (1 position)
  • ​Provides medical care to sick or injured campers and staff; works with local doctor
Program Assistants (2 positions)
  • ​Assist Program director with group games and other program activities
Hospitality Assistant (1 position)
  • ​Responsible for laundry, cleaning of guest rooms and bathrooms, and various other ancillary tasks  
Office Assistant (1 position)
  • ​Responsible for answering phone, online registrations, printing/copying, organizing                                     Photo/Video Technician (1 position)
  • ​Responsible for taking photos each week and putting together end of week video; promotional material
Maintenance Assistant (1 position)
  • Responsible for collecting trash, weed-eating, replacing light bulbs, miscellaneous items needing fixed
